Description
Summary:According to literary tradition Justin the Second turned over supreme power to the caesar Tiberius in the 574 because of the impossibility govern the empire. But the main sources tell us about ill emperor’s intermittent participation in the significant state affairs. In this connection a question arises on the ability of emperor, and on bounds of the power of caesar and impress. The article answers the question with aid of different sources data and interdisciplinary approach as well.
